Through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) technology, the reasoning power of LLMs is physically isolated from dynamically updated authoritative medical knowledge bases, achieving "knowledge-action unity".
Vectorized processing of CSCO/NCCN guidelines and top-tier journal articles
Semantic retrieval + logical reranking to ensure evidence best aligned with clinical pathways
Model must cite retrieved context; refuses to answer without relevant evidence
